草庐IT

awayMessage

全部标签

javascript - react 输入默认值不随状态更新

我正在尝试使用React创建一个简单的表单,但在将数据正确绑定(bind)到表单的默认值时遇到困难。我正在寻找的行为是这样的:当我打开我的页面时,文本输入字段应该填入我数据库中的AwayMessage文本。那就是“示例文本”理想情况下,如果我的数据库中的AwayMessage没有文本,我希望在文本输入字段中有一个占位符。但是,现在,我发现每次刷新页面时文本输入字段都是空白的。(虽然我在输入中输入的内容确实正确保存并持续存在。)我认为这是因为当AwayMessage是空对象时输入文本字段的html加载,但当awayMessage加载时不刷新。此外,我无法为该字段指定默认值。为了清晰起见,

javascript - react 输入默认值不随状态更新

我正在尝试使用React创建一个简单的表单,但在将数据正确绑定(bind)到表单的默认值时遇到困难。我正在寻找的行为是这样的:当我打开我的页面时,文本输入字段应该填入我数据库中的AwayMessage文本。那就是“示例文本”理想情况下,如果我的数据库中的AwayMessage没有文本,我希望在文本输入字段中有一个占位符。但是,现在,我发现每次刷新页面时文本输入字段都是空白的。(虽然我在输入中输入的内容确实正确保存并持续存在。)我认为这是因为当AwayMessage是空对象时输入文本字段的html加载,但当awayMessage加载时不刷新。此外,我无法为该字段指定默认值。为了清晰起见,